Seventeen-year-old Filipino-origin player Dro Fernandez is making waves at Barcelona.

Dro Fernández, a 17-year-old midfielder of Filipino descent trained at La Masia, recently made his official debut for Barcelona’s first team in the match against Real Sociedad on September 28 during La Liga’s seventh round. Trusted by coach Hansi Flick and wearing the number 27 jersey, he played the entire first half, impressing with his refined technique, sharp vision, and rare confidence. According to Sofascore, Dro had 32 touches, a 92% pass accuracy rate (24 out of 26), created 2 key passes, and successfully completed 2 out of 3 dribbles.

Defensively, he was also active, winning 3 out of 5 ground duels and 1 out of 1 aerial challenge. Barcelona’s official site wrote about the 17-year-old: "A new milestone for Pedro Fernández 'Dro' with FC Barcelona. The midfielder, trained at La Masia, made his official first-team debut against Real Sociedad at the Estadi Olímpic Lluís Companys. At just 17 years old and wearing number 27, he played the entire first half for Barca."
